Ana Neiva

Assistant Coordinator (Strategy)
Academic Researcher and Architectural Investigator

Ana Neiva holds a Ph.D. from the Faculty of Architecture of the University of Porto (FAUP) with a thesis titled "Exhibiting Portuguese Architecture: Twentieth-century Curatorial Strategies." As an invited Assistant Professor, she teaches at FAUP, where she is an integrated member of CEAU, and at FCAATI Universidade Lusófona, where she serves as the vice-director of ARQ.ID. Her research work, regularly presented at national and international conferences, focuses on the expansion of architecture into the realms of art, society, health, and well-being, as well as architectural curation. This is reflected in her professional journey: "Porto - The City, the School, and the Masters," UABB 2015 (Shenzhen), "Lo studio Ginoulhiac - 10 Anni. 10 Case. 10 Temi di Architettura" (Bergamo and Porto, 2019); and "Fertile Futures" - Official Portuguese Representation at the 18th International Architecture Exhibition of La Biennale di Venezia 2023 (deputy-curator), are examples of a practice that also extends to interior ship design.
